UPC-MERIT scholarship UPC is soliciting applications for study grants to cover the enrollment rates for the master's degree taught at UPC Manresa in Machine Learning and Cybersecurity for Internet-Connected Systems. The intention of this scholarship is to benefit students from the project's high-quality education in digital areas and promote equality in the field of computer science. Everyone is welcome to apply regardless of their personal situation, but gender equality and socioeconomic status are also factors to receiving this scholarship. The scholarship supports the official total tuition expense (see entry "How much does the master's cost?" in the FAQ). In particular, it covers: The tuition costs and other fees and rates charged by UPC for a master full semester (30 ECTS) during three consecutive semesters. Principal requirements for applicants The scholarship will only be granted to persons admitted to the master's program in Machine Learning and Cybersecurity for Internet-Connected Systems at UPC Manresa for the 2024–2025 academic year. This means that to be considered for the scholarship applicants will have to apply concurrently to the master's program. Being an EU Citizen. Being a full-time degree seeking student in the master's degree program in the 2024–2025 academic year. Every semester writing a report on their experience and learning outcomes. Selection criteria Academic merit will be the predominant factor in deciding who gets the scholarship, but the committee will also take into account the gender and socioeconomic disparities in engineering and computer science. The scholarship committee will take into account both the documents from the application to the master's program and the additional documentation provided through this call. Budget The total budget of this call amounts to 52.500€. The maximum amount per scholarship is 3.500€.
